Altman warns of an AI bubble—should you worry?

Is Altman right about an AI bubble? … Plus, Powell at Jackson Hole… Alphabet (GOOG) and Amazon's (AMZN) latest power deals… Why Target (TGT) is selling off... The government's Intel (INTC) deal... And SPACs are back.

In this episode:

  • The PGA Tour: Scheffler's odds are laughable [0:39]
  • Sam Altman says AI is in a bubble—is he right? [3:30]
  • Powell at Jackson Hole: What to expect from the Fed Chair [11:40]
  • Why Google is scaling up its stake in this highly shorted stock [15:05]
  • Amazon's FLEX deal: What are cashless warrants? [21:30]
  • Why Wall Street is punishing Target's executive move [27:55]
  • The government's stake in Intel: Good for taxpayers or slippery slope? [33:50]
  • SPACs are back—will retail investors get screwed again? [47:33]
